Biological Background: NFYB Function and Localization
- NFYB encodes the beta subunit of the nuclear transcription factor Y (NF-Y), a heterotrimeric complex that includes NF-YA and NF-YC subunits. This complex specifically binds to the CCAAT box motif (5'-CCAAT-3') in eukaryotic promoters.
- NF-Y can act as a transcriptional activator or repressor, depending on its interacting cofactors, allowing it to fine-tune gene expression in response to various signaling pathways.
- Consistent with its transcription factor role, NFYB localizes exclusively to the nucleus, where it participates in DNA binding and transcriptional regulation.
- The protein is subject to post-translational modifications including ubiquitination and isopeptide bond formation, which may modulate its stability, interactions, or activity.
- NFYB is also known by aliases HAP3, CBF-A, CBF-B, and NF-YB, reflecting its historical identification in different experimental contexts.
- With a calculated molecular weight of approximately 22.8 kDa, the full-length human NFYB protein comprises 207 amino acids, as covered by the immunogen used to generate this antibody.
Experimental Guidance and Technical Tips
- For Western blotting, starting antibody dilutions should be empirically optimized; typical rabbit polyclonal antibodies may work in the range of 1:500–1:2000, but validation in the relevant tissue or cell lysate is essential.
- The antibody is reported to detect human and mouse NFYB. When working with other species, perform sequence alignment and consider testing cross-reactivity experimentally.
- In ELISA applications, the antibody can be employed as a capture or detection reagent; pairing with an appropriate secondary antibody is required for signal generation.
- As NFYB is a nuclear protein, using nuclear extraction protocols is recommended to enrich the target and minimize background from cytoplasmic proteins.
- Since the immunogen spans the nearly full-length protein (aa 1–207), the polyclonal antibody likely recognizes multiple epitopes, but be aware of potential isoform-specific reactivity if splice variants exist.
